MAX6889/MAX6890/MAX6891
EEPROM-Programmable, Octal/Hex/Quad,
Power-Supply Sequencers/Supervisors
_______________________________________________________________________________________
9
Pin Description (continued)
PIN
MAX6889
MAX6890
MAX6891
NAME
FUNCTION
12
10
7
MR
Manual Reset Input.
MR is configurable to either assert PO_ into a programmed
state or to have no effect on PO_ when driving
MR low (see Table 6). Leave MR
unconnected or connect to DBP if unused.
MR is internally pulled up to DBP
through a 10A current source.
13
11
8
SDA
Serial Data Input/Output (Open Drain). SDA requires an external pullup resistor.
14
12
9
SCL
Serial Clock Input. SCL requires an external pullup resistor.
15
13
10
A0
Address Input 0. Address inputs allow up to four (MAX6889/MAX6890) or two
(MAX6891) connections on one common bus. Connect A0 to GND or to the
serial-interface power supply.
16
14
A1
Address Input 1. Address inputs allow up to four MAX6889/MAX6890
connections on one common bus. Connect A1 to GND or to the serial-interface
power supply.
17
15
GPI4
General-Purpose Logic Input 4. An internal 10A current source pulls GPI4 to
GND. Configure GPI4 to control watchdog timer functions or the programmable
outputs.
18
16
11
GPI3
General-Purpose Logic Input 3. An internal 10A current source pulls GPI3 to
GND. Configure GPI3 to control watchdog timer functions or the programmable
outputs.
19
17
12
GPI2
General-Purpose Logic Input 2. An internal 10A current source pulls GPI2 to
GND. Configure GPI2 to control watchdog timer functions or the programmable
outputs.
20
18
13
GPI1
General-Purpose Logic Input 1. An internal 10A current source pulls GPI1 to
GND. Configure GPI1 to control watchdog timer functions or the programmable
outputs.
21
19
14
VCC
Internal Power-Supply Voltage. Bypass VCC to GND with a 1F ceramic
capacitor. VCC supplies power to the internal circuitry. VCC is internally powered
from the highest of the monitored IN1–IN5 voltages. Do not use VCC to supply
power to external circuitry. To externally supply VCC, see the Powering the
MAX6889/MAX6890/MAX6891 section.
22
20
15
DBP
Internal Digital Power-Supply Voltage. Bypass DBP to GND with a 1F ceramic
capacitor. DBP supplies power to the EEPROM memory, the internal logic
circuitry, and the programmable outputs. Do not use DBP to supply power to
external circuitry.
23
IN8
High-Voltage Input 8. Configure IN8 to detect voltage thresholds from 2.5V to
15.25V in 50mV increments, or 1.25V to 7.625V in 25mV increments. For
improved noise immunity, bypass IN8 to GND with a 0.1F capacitor installed as
close to the device as possible.
24
IN7
Voltage Input 7. Configure IN7 to detect voltage thresholds between 1V and 5.5V
in 20mV increments, or 0.5V to 3.05V in 10mV increments. For improved noise
immunity, bypass IN7 to GND with a 0.1F capacitor installed as close to the
device as possible.
